Hi

I would like to print my sales order invoice  as batch process. I'm able to print it manually. but when i try to schedule it as batch, i get errors.

I did the following things before running my batch.
1.  Created New Configuration entry (in both Server & Client Configuration Utility) with same name and TCP/IP Port as "2712"
2.  Checked "Connect to printers on the Server" - Client Configuration Utility
3.  Checked "Allow clients to connect to printers on this Server" - Server Configuration Utility
4.  Configured to a network printer & Outlook Email Client.
5.  AOS service (Dynamics AX Object Server 5.0$01-DynamicsAx1) runs by using "Admistrator" login credentials.
6. When I do "Post Invoice" maually, I'm able to PRINT, EMAIL, POST TO FILE without any issue

Once my batch is done, the Sales Order Status is changed to "Invoiced" as expected, but got printing errors.

 Could someone help me what is the issue?

I'm using Dynamics AX  2009 (5.0) version
